Per Diem Archive: M.H. Lester, August 2020, Crimes of Passion

Poems for the Per Diem/Daily Haiku for August 2020 as selected by M.H. Lester.

[back]
Author: Cherie Hunter Day
wrought ironclad alibis
Author: Cb Crane
slow dancing
he is eternally charming
his knife almost kind
Author: David G. Lanoue
pizza parlor
after the murders
help wanted
Author: Gregory Longenecker
divorce
we leave the scene
of the accident
Author: George Swede
streetwalker
with a black eye halo
around the moon
Author: Roberta Beary
after bashing her to bits bruised sunlight
Author: Joe McKeon
aftershock
my estranged son
unfriends me
Author: John Hawkhead
time to ourselves
it will not be long
before she wants to kill me
Author: Kathy Uyen Nguyen
COVID lockdown
the black and blues
of a battered face
Author: Lori A Minor
admitting he hit me hailstorm
Author: Bob Lucky
birth control
my mother threatens
to kill me
Author: Michael McClintock
woodland mold-
the missing girl
wore pearls
Author: Michael Nickels-Wisdom
the horizon
smoking a cigarette
like a murderer
Author: Theresa A. Cancro
police siren...
the hard stare
of an inner-city kid
Author: Robin Anna Smith
sex worker
the way she escapes
her father
Author: Ron C. Moss
a last strum
the dark goes deeper
into the strings
Author: Susan Burch
getting rid of
all evidence of him –
douche
Author: Rachel Sutcliffe
asking you to leave
one bruised apple
left in the bowl
Author: John McManus
we give in to our urges— wolf moon
Author: John Kinory
closing night party I discard the dagger I never used
Author: James Chessing
beach cliff eroding
to have never been loved
by a father
Author: Nick Virgilio
the sack of kittens
sinking in the icy creek,
increases the cold
Author: Simon Hanson
shattered glass the pulse of red light
Author: Grant Hayes
the moon-addled moth
willing the pane a portal
beats its wings to dust
Author: Larry Kimmel
brushing straw
from her sweater – the promise
not to tell
